A couple of weeks ago court tv broadcast a trial which they decided to dub "The Cursing Canoeist" trial. The (true of course) story goes: A 25 year old man(Tim Boomer) was on vacation w/ friends in michigan, canoeing on a river. The canoe apparently hit a rock, and Boomer fell out of the canoe. What happened next was in dispute at the trial, but there was a grown couple, also canoeing in close proximatey to Boomer and his group, who claimed on the witness stand that after Boomer fell out of the canoe he proceeded to launch into a tirade, screaming obsceneties at his friends for five to seven minutes. They claim he used the word fuck from 50 to 75 times, all directed at his friends, in phrases such as "You fucking bitches" and "I hate this fucking trip" and just plain "Fuck, fuck, fuck!" A deputy also patrolling the area heard him cursing too, and issued him a ticket, for in michigan it is against the law to use "obscene laguage". Boomer chose to fight the ticket in court, where an attorney from the ACLU defended him. Boomer didnt take the stand, but his fellow canoers and attorney claimed that he only said the word fuck a few times and was never in an angry tirade, but simply having fun. He was convicted of the "crime" and faces the possibility of 90 days in jail and a fine (sentencing delayed until after the appeal).
